Venous-to-Arterial Carbon Dioxide Gradient and Its Ratio to Arterial-central Venous Oxygen Content Difference in Assessing Oxygen Metabolism and Tissue Perfusion in Septic Shock: A Prospective Observational Study

摘要

BACKGROUND: Traditional biomarkers such as lactate and central venous oxygen saturation (ScvO₂) have limitations in accurately reflecting tissue perfusion and oxygen metabolism in septic shock. This study investigates the prognostic value of central venous-to-arterial carbon dioxide difference (Pcv-aCO₂) and its ratio to arterial-central venous oxygen content difference (Pcv-aCO₂/Ca-cvO₂) in evaluating oxygen metabolism and guiding resuscitation in septic shock. METHODS: A prospective observational cohort study was conducted in a tertiary university intensive care unit (ICU) from October 2020 to December 2022. Ninety adult patients diagnosed with septic shock within 24 hours of ICU admission were enrolled and stratified into four groups based on Pcv-aCO₂ (cutoff: 6 mmHg) and Pcv-aCO₂/Ca-cvO₂ ratio (cutoff: 1.8). Arterial and central venous blood gas analyses were performed on ICU days 1, 2, 3, and 5. Dynamic changes in ScvO₂, lactate, Pcv-aCO₂, and Pcv-aCO₂/Ca-cvO₂ were recorded. The primary outcome was 28-day mortality. Logistic regression and ROC analysis were used to identify independent prognostic indicators. RESULTS: Only Group A (Pcv-aCO₂≤6 mmHg and Pcv-aCO₂/Ca-cvO₂≤1.8) showed significant reductions in lactate levels over time (P = 0.003). Elevated Pcv-aCO₂ and Pcv-aCO₂/Ca-cvO₂ were associated with lower ScvO₂ and persistently high lactate levels, indicating inadequate tissue oxygenation. On day 2 of ICU admission, Pcv-aCO₂ positively correlated with fluid intake (r = 0.259, P = 0.016), highlighting the importance of restrictive fluid resuscitation. Pcv-aCO₂ on day 3 (cutoff: 7.64 mmHg; AUC: 0.667) and APACHE II score (cutoff: 27.5; AUC: 0.725) independently predicted 28-day mortality. Their combination achieved the highest predictive value (AUC: 0.972, P = 0.040). CONCLUSION: In patients with septic shock, elevated Pcv-aCO₂ and Pcv-aCO₂/Ca-cvO₂ ratios are associated with impaired oxygen metabolism and worse outcomes, even when conventional markers appear normal. These parameters may serve as more sensitive indicators of tissue hypoperfusion in guiding early resuscitation efforts.
